E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ph captures the radiant smile and effortless grace of the legendary American actress and dancer, Ginger Rogers, in the early stages of her illustrious career. Circa 1931, this image showcases Rogers in her prime, exuding confidence and charisma as she poses for the camera. Known for her striking beauty and impeccable dance skills, Rogers quickly rose to fame in the world of entertainment, becoming a household name and an icon of Hollywood's Golden Age. Born in 1911 in Fort Worth, Texas, Rogers began her career as a dancer in vaudeville shows before making the transition to films. Her partnership with dance partner and eventual husband, Fred Astaire, in a series of RKO pictures during the late 1930s and early 1940s, cemented her status as a leading lady and a formidable talent. Rogers' signature style, characterized by her elegant poise and playful charm, resonated with audiences and critics alike. Her ability to captivate both on and off the screen made her a beloved figure in American popular culture.
